AI Frontiers in Finance
With the AI Frontiers in Finance webinar, we created a quarterly webinar series dedicated to “opening the black box” as to the technical foundations of “AI in Finance” research and providing a bridge to its practical implications and business applications. We want to raise awareness of the AI applications used in academic research and their potential for broader application. This way, the webinar will differ from others by combining expertise and fostering a dialogue that enriches both the academic and professional communities.
Each session brings together an academic and an industry speaker who explore a specific topic relevant to AI in finance, such as AI governance, credit markets, or data infrastructure, through the lens of a real-world case. Drawing on complementary perspectives, academics contribute evidence-based frameworks and research insights, while industry experts share practical experience and lessons learned from implementation. Together, they connect theory and practice, translating key insights into concrete solutions, practical recommendations, and actionable steps that participants can apply immediately.
Session 13 - 8 September 2026
In our next session on 8 September, Albert Menkveld (VU Amsterdam) will talk about how AI systems make decisions in complex analytical tasks, how these decisions differ from those of human experts, and what the implications are for the use of AI in practice.
